I have installed Dropbox on my laptops and my phone. On my laptops I use it for two purposes: synchronization and backup. Initially, I used it for synchronization of my private and my work laptop (both computers are running Linux).

The laptop at work is a bit unstable. It crashes probably 3-4 times a week, and I believe it has something to do with the temperature of the processor. It happened to me the other way, and an OpenOffice document was left in a state where the file did not contain anything else that zeroes.

Luckily, Dropbox keeps track on my revisions of the files. That means that I was able to go one revision back and recover much of my file (probably lost half a page). Needless to say, I'm pretty happy with the Dropbox service now!

Peter Toft and I are in the process of preparing Emacsforum 2011 with some help by Troels Henriksen (at DIKU) and Keld Simonsen (from KLID). The program is almost ready for publication, so I will not say too much - but there will be something for scientists and developers. Even our Evil Twin will be represented.

The mini-conference takes place 12th November 2011 at DIKU. The is no conference fee - and there will be no benifits.

If you are using Emacs (and even XEmacs) and live in the Copenhagen area, Emacsforum is a good place to meet fellow users.
